Output 3be786cc91daa72a705e2de830c6d3507ec2ef863aa997dc0440698d67b68807:0

value
9426819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5288aa6086482f3bbb3e4a2f029e05c0d83a8cb OP_EQUAL
address
3NahEMPhFGtsYRsP21LVuZU1FRJVWi6HfP
transaction
3be786cc91daa72a705e2de830c6d3507ec2ef863aa997dc0440698d67b68807
spent
true